## Onboarding: Alertfold Deduplicator

Alertfold sits between our monitors and the paging service, collapsing duplicate alerts within a ten-minute window keyed on fingerprint. Reviewers should pay attention to anything touching the fingerprint function — a change there silently alters dedup behavior and can double-page the on-call. Tests live under `dedup/window_test` and must cover boundary timestamps. The service won't start without credentials for the paging relay; local runs need an env file that includes this line:

env line for yahip-tafog: RELAY_SECRET3=4ca

Welcome aboard! The FeedCheck validator is what we run every podcast feed through before it hits the Larkspur distribution pipeline. Most endpoints are open internally, but the validation-report endpoint talks to our internal metadata service, and that one needs a key. Don't worry about provisioning your own for now — contractors use the shared staging credential, which rotates monthly, so expect it to change on you at least once. Include it in the auth header on each request. Here's the current key.

API key for kajog-tajep: zpat11_KM2XGfcA8zM

Hedging Decision — Managers Only

Heads of department: effective this quarter, Arvento Ltd hedges 65% of pellar-denominated revenue using twelve-month forwards. Spot conversion is discontinued. Treasury owns execution; finance reports variance monthly. Budget rates are fixed at contract rates. No department-level exceptions. The reasoning behind this shift is recorded in the confidential note below.

board note of kageg-yajog: Gross margin on Ulaath came in at 10 percent against a plan of 10 percent. Only 7 of the 100 pilot accounts renewed Ulaath, so a churn review is set for October 15.

Welcome to the Brindlehook scanner rotation! This job crawls our internal registry nightly and flags packages whose names sit within edit-distance two of popular dependencies. If it pages you, don't panic — most hits are false positives from the Tarnwell monorepo's fork naming scheme. Quarantine first, ask questions after, and log your decision in the triage channel. Reference the scan run using the token below.

session token of bawep-yadup = htk21_528abd376e3c5a4ec24a1